Maintenance Requirements

Maintenance requirements are an integral part of two strand twist styles for medium length hair. Regular care and attention are necessary to keep the twists looking their best and protect the hair from damage.

  • Moisturizing

    Two strand twists need to be moisturized regularly to prevent the hair from becoming dry and brittle. This can be done with a variety of products, such as leave-in conditioners, oils, or creams.

  • Retwisting

    As two strand twists grow out, they will begin to unravel. To keep the twists looking neat and tidy, they will need to be retwisted every few weeks. This can be done at home or by a professional stylist.

  • Washing

    Two strand twists should be washed regularly to remove dirt and product buildup. However, it is important to avoid washing the twists too often, as this can strip the hair of its natural oils.

  • Protective styling

    When not styled, two strand twists should be protected from friction and tangles. This can be done by wearing a satin bonnet or scarf at night.

By following these maintenance requirements, you can keep your two strand twist styles looking their best and protect your hair from damage.

Question 1: What are the benefits of two strand twist styles for medium length hair?

Answer: Two strand twist styles offer numerous benefits, including protecting hair from damage, reducing breakage, and promoting hair growth. They are also a versatile style that can be worn in a variety of ways, making them suitable for different occasions and personal preferences.

Question 2: How long does it take to create two strand twist styles?

Answer: The time it takes to create two strand twist styles varies depending on the length and thickness of the hair. On average, it can take anywhere from 2 to 4 hours to complete a full head of twists.

Question 3: How long do two strand twist styles last?

Answer: With proper care and maintenance, two strand twist styles can last for several weeks, typically ranging from 2 to 4 weeks or longer. Regular moisturizing and retwisting are key to maintaining the longevity and health of the twists.

Question 4: Can two strand twist styles damage hair?

Answer: When done properly and with proper care, two strand twist styles should not damage hair. In fact, they can help to protect hair from damage caused by heat styling, chemical treatments, and environmental factors.

Question 5: What are some tips for maintaining two strand twist styles?

Answer: To maintain two strand twist styles, it is important to moisturize the hair regularly, retwist the twists as needed, and wear a satin bonnet or scarf at night to prevent frizz and tangles. Regular trims are also recommended to remove any split ends and keep the hair healthy.

Question 6: Can two strand twist styles be worn on all hair types?

Answer: Two strand twist styles are suitable for all hair types, including natural, relaxed, or color-treated hair. However, the size and definition of the twists may vary depending on the texture and porosity of the hair.

Styling Tips for Two Strand Twist Styles

This section provides detailed, actionable tips to guide you in creating stunning and personalized two strand twist styles. By following these tips, you can enhance the beauty of your natural hair and express your unique style.

Tip 1: Prepare your hair: Before twisting, wash and condition your hair to remove dirt and product buildup. Apply a leave-in conditioner to provide moisture and detangle your hair.

Tip 2: Section your hair: Divide your hair into smaller sections to make the twisting process more manageable. Use clips or hair ties to keep the sections separate.

Tip 3: Use the right products: Choose styling products that are designed for natural hair, such as curl creams, gels, or pomades. These products will help to define and hold your twists.

Tip 4: Twist in small sections: For tighter, more defined twists, work with smaller sections of hair. This will create a more polished and intricate look.

Tip 5: Twist away from your face: When twisting, twist the hair away from your face to create a more flattering and lifted look.

Tip 6: Moisturize regularly: To keep your twists looking healthy and hydrated, apply a moisturizer or oil to them daily. This will prevent dryness and breakage.

Tip 7: Retwist as needed: As your twists grow out, they will begin to unravel. Retwist them every few weeks to maintain their shape and definition.

Tip 8: Accessorize your twists: Add some flair to your twists by accessorizing with headbands, scarves, or hair clips. This will instantly elevate your look and make your twists more versatile.

By following these tips, you can create beautiful and long-lasting two strand twist styles that showcase the beauty of your natural hair. These versatile twists can be styled in a variety of ways, allowing you to express your personal style and creativity.
